How to solve the waterproof and anti-corrosion problems of container houses?

Waterproof Solutions
Sealing: Apply high-performance sealant at all joints (wall/ceiling/floor, door/window frames) and stick waterproof sealing strips; weld container steel joints tightly and touch up anti-rust paint.
Roof treatment: Pave waterproof roll materials (S BS/APP) or spray polyurethane waterproof coating; add a sloped roof cover (color steel tile) to guide water flow and avoid ponding.
Floor waterproof: Lay a waterproof membrane under the floor base, and use moisture-proof cement fiberboard/PVC flooring for the surface layer; set drainage holes at the bottom of the container for ground water seepage.
Anti-Corrosion Solutions
Steel structure anti-rust: Derust the original container steel plate thoroughly (sandblasting/grinding), then brush 2-3 layers of anti-rust paint + topcoat; spray anti-corrosion fireproof paint for keels and frames.
Humidity control: Install ventilation fans/air vents to reduce indoor moisture; lay a moisture-proof layer (pearl cotton/foam board) between the container and the ground to isolate ground moisture.
External protection: Paste anti-corrosion aluminum-plastic panels/ceramic tiles on the outer wall; galvanize or spray plastic on exposed steel parts (bolts, brackets) for secondary protection.
